Prostate cancer Pill-Taking habits under the microscope
NCT ID NCT07451002
First seen Mar 17, 2026 · Last updated May 20, 2026 · Updated 11 times
Summary
This study watches how closely men with advanced prostate cancer follow their prescribed apalutamide treatment over one year. Researchers will track medication adherence and look for patterns that might predict who struggles to stay on track. The goal is to understand real-world behavior, not to test a new drug.
